The Departure of a Defensive Titan
Manchester United announced this week that Casemiro will depart the club as a free agent at the season's conclusion. The 33-year-old's substantial £350,000-per-week contract reaches its natural end in the coming months, with United deciding against offering an extension to the veteran midfielder.
Casemiro arrived at Old Trafford in August 2022 during Erik ten Hag's early tenure, commanding a £60 million transfer fee from Real Madrid. The defensive midfielder made an immediate impact during his debut campaign, contributing seven goals and seven assists despite his primarily defensive responsibilities.
A Legacy of Defensive Excellence
Throughout his United career, Casemiro has made 146 appearances and scored 21 goals, though his most significant contributions have consistently come in defensive situations. The five-time Champions League winner established himself as a crucial protective presence in front of United's back line.
Shaw's comments from a 2023 press conference now resonate particularly strongly as Casemiro prepares his exit. The England left-back explained: "I think it's obvious to see how important he is to the team. For us as defenders, it gives us a feeling of security. He loves to win the ball back and tackle."
The Revealing Dressing Room Humour
Shaw then shared the private joke that has illuminated how United players genuinely perceive Casemiro's defensive mindset: "We joke he likes to give the ball away so he can win it back. I'm very happy to have him back tomorrow night because he's been a big miss for us."
This humorous observation from within the United camp highlights both Casemiro's exceptional ball-winning abilities and what teammates perceived as a minor flaw in his game. The joke suggests players recognized his occasional tendency to lose possession, but valued his immediate response to regain it through his renowned tackling.
International Recognition of Quality
Casemiro's defensive qualities have earned praise beyond Old Trafford. His Brazilian international teammate Raphinha previously told ESPN Brasil: "Casemiro is a player that I'd particularly like to have on my team. Because in addition to the experience he has in football, in the things he has achieved in football, he's a great leader, he's a great person and he manages to complete a team with the football, with the quality he has, and with the defensive part that for me, he's one of the best defensive midfielders in the world."
What United Will Miss
As Casemiro prepares to depart, United face losing not only his defensive capabilities but also his experienced voice in the dressing room. The club has already begun exploring midfield reinforcements, with several younger players linked to Old Trafford as United rebuild their engine room for next season.
Casemiro himself reflected on his time at United this week, stating: "I will carry Manchester United with me throughout my entire life. From the first day that I walked out at this beautiful stadium, I felt the passion of Old Trafford and the love that I now share with our supporters for this special club."
"It is not time to say goodbye; there are many more memories to create during the next four months. We still have a lot to fight for together; my complete focus will, as always, remain on giving my everything to help our club to succeed."
